Magna Concursos

Foram encontradas 24.479 questões.

1258794 Ano: 2019
Disciplina: TI - Banco de Dados
Banca: AOCP
Orgão: IBGE
Um dos requisitos de uma determinada empresa é que seus colaboradores podem ser casados. Um analista de sistemas precisa representar essa regra de negócio em um banco de dados. Sabendo que os dados dos colaboradores a serem armazenados são: matrícula e nome do colaborador, sendo a matrícula a chave primária, assinale a alternativa que apresenta o código SQL para a criação da(s) tabela(s) que representa o seguinte modelo conceitual em um banco de dados relacional.
Enunciado 1258794-1
 

Provas

Questão presente nas seguintes provas
1258793 Ano: 2019
Disciplina: TI - Banco de Dados
Banca: AOCP
Orgão: IBGE
Pedro foi contratado para desenvolver um sistema para o departamento de Tecnologia da Informação de uma grande empresa e esse sistema será responsável pela gestão dos pedidos de atendimentos dos usuários. Quase na etapa do desenvolvimento da ferramenta, ele precisa fazer uma exclusão de um atendimento que foi finalizado pelos funcionários do departamento a partir do id desse funcionário (123). A tabela atendimento possui os seguintes campos: id, nome, descricao, prazo e prioridade. Sabendo que Pedro está utilizando a versão 8.0 do banco de dados MySQL, assinale a alternativa que apresenta a SQL correta para essa ação.
 

Provas

Questão presente nas seguintes provas
1258790 Ano: 2019
Disciplina: TI - Banco de Dados
Banca: AOCP
Orgão: IBGE

Além das estruturas procedurais da PL/SQL, como funções e procedimentos, também é possível implementar os tipos objetos.

Sabendo disso, analise as assertivas a respeito dos tipos objetos da PL/SQL e assinale a alternativa que aponta a(s) correta(s).

I. Seus métodos de instância são estáticos.

II. Eles escondem dados e operações.

III. Variáveis estáticas não estão disponíveis na PL/SQL.

 

Provas

Questão presente nas seguintes provas
1258789 Ano: 2019
Disciplina: TI - Banco de Dados
Banca: AOCP
Orgão: IBGE
Normalização pode ser entendida como o processo de modelar o banco de dados levando em conta as informações que serão armazenadas, com o objetivo de eliminar ou, pelo menos, reduzir as redundâncias. Um banco de dados que leva em conta os padrões de normalização reduz a manutenção e aumenta o seu desempenho.
Assim, analise as assertivas a seguir e assinale a alternativa que apresenta corretamente com qual forma normal cada assertiva está ligada.
I. Quando analisamos uma tupla e não encontramos um atributo não chave dependente de outro atributo não chave.
II. Quando não existir dependências multivaloradas entre seus atributos.
III. Quando os registros na tabela, que não são chaves, dependam da chave primária em sua totalidade e não apenas parte dela.
IV. Quando todos os atributos contêm apenas um valor correspondente, singular, e não existem grupos de atributos repetidos.
 

Provas

Questão presente nas seguintes provas
1258788 Ano: 2019
Disciplina: TI - Banco de Dados
Banca: AOCP
Orgão: IBGE
A abordagem Entidade-Relacionamento (E-R) foi definida por Peter Pin-Shan Chen em 1976 e representa um modelo conceitual do banco de dados independente da implementação física. Esse modelo possui regras para representar as relações entre elementos de um esquema. Assinale a alternativa que descreve, para a abordagem E-R, o que representa a cardinalidade máxima.
 

Provas

Questão presente nas seguintes provas
1258787 Ano: 2019
Disciplina: TI - Banco de Dados
Banca: AOCP
Orgão: IBGE
Tiago é o DBA, administrador de banco de dados, da sua empresa e, durante um processo de consulta ao banco de dados, ele pretende utilizar uma função chamada SUBSTRING. Para testar a sintaxe e o funcionamento dessa função, Tiago executou o seguinte comando no seu banco de dados SQL:
select substring( ‘CONCURSO’, 6,3);
Qual será o resultado dessa consulta aplicada por Tiago?
 

Provas

Questão presente nas seguintes provas
1258786 Ano: 2019
Disciplina: TI - Banco de Dados
Banca: AOCP
Orgão: IBGE
A seguir, é apresentado o SQL que realiza uma consulta que implementa um determinado relatório:
SELECT PRO.NOME, COUNT(ELE.ID) QTD
FROM PRODUTO PRO
JOIN ELEMENTO ELE ON (PRO.ID = ELE.PRODUTO)
JOIN VENDA VEN ON (VEN.ID = ELE.VENDA)
WHERE VEN.DATA_VENDA >= SYSDATE-10
AND ROWNUM <= 20
GROUP BY PRO.NOME
ORDER BY 2 DESC
Assinale a alternativa que descreve o que esse relatório apresenta ao usuário.
 

Provas

Questão presente nas seguintes provas
1258785 Ano: 2019
Disciplina: TI - Banco de Dados
Banca: AOCP
Orgão: IBGE
Gilmar está utilizando o SGBD Oracle 11g e pretende buscar a posição inicial de um padrão compatível de expressão regular. Para obter esse retorno, qual função de expressão regular ele deve utilizar?
 

Provas

Questão presente nas seguintes provas
1258784 Ano: 2019
Disciplina: TI - Banco de Dados
Banca: AOCP
Orgão: IBGE
Um sistema legado do IBGE possui uma única e grande tabela para armazenamento de dados do censo 2010. Isso resultou em uma grande quantidade de dados redundantes e, ainda, consultas demoradas mesmo para poucas quantidades de linhas. A fim de resolver o problema para o sistema do censo de 2020, os analistas de sistemas aplicaram a FNBC (Forma Normal de Boyce-Codd). Nesse sentido, foram utilizadas as 1FN, 2FN e 3FN.
Sabendo disso, assinale a alternativa que descreva corretamente a 3FN utilizad a para resolver o problema.
 

Provas

Questão presente nas seguintes provas
1258783 Ano: 2019
Disciplina: TI - Banco de Dados
Banca: AOCP
Orgão: IBGE
Considerando que a linguagem SQL é a linguagem padrão em um sistema gerenciador de banco de dados, assinale a alternativa que apresenta corretamente um exemplo de comando em DDL (Data Definition Language).
 

Provas

Questão presente nas seguintes provas